E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ases Georges Pierre Seurat's masterpiece, "Walking, c. 1882". Created with conte crayon on paper, this drawing exemplifies Seurat's mastery of the pointillist technique. The image measures 30.5x23 cm and is currently held in a private collection. Seurat, a prominent figure in the neo-impressionist movement, skillfully captures the essence of a male walker through his meticulous use of dots and dashes. The viewer can almost feel the rhythmic motion as they observe each carefully placed mark coming together to form a cohesive whole. The artist's attention to detail is evident in every aspect of this piece - from the texture of clothing to the subtle play of light and shadow on the subject's face. Through his unique approach to painting, Seurat invites us into a world where individual brushstrokes blend seamlessly to create an overall impression.
